Cross-platform App Development Benefits FinTech Sector

If you are wondering why that is, allow us to list some of the many, many benefits of using cross-platform app development for the FinTech sector:

1. Security: It goes without saying that security is among the most important considerations for a FinTech company. After all, such businesses have to deal with highly sensitive data, including customers’ financial details, on a daily basis. Cross-platform app development is a terrific tool in this context as well; no matter which framework you pick, you can rest assured that it will come integrated with ample features for security, including encryption, multiple authentication plugins, etc.

2. Scalability: A critical benefit of cross-platform app development is that all the many, many frameworks for it bring forth not only next-level agility as well as scalability. This is thanks to the fact that cross-platform app development allows developers to reuse as much as 90 per cent of the code. This means a cross-platform FinTech app can not only be quickly updated when needed but also be completely tailored in accordance to the business’ requirements.

3. Engage with a bigger audience: One of the biggest benefits of cross-platform development, especially for FinTech companies, is the ability to reach a bigger audience. You see, when you use this form of development, you are able to develop one app for a variety of platforms in one go. This means you do not have to spend time working on different apps for different platforms and reach existing as well as potential new customers on whichever devices they use. As you can imagine, bigger the audience base for the FinTech company, better for the business.

4. Better user experience: It goes without saying that ensuring the delivery of a high quality user experience for the FinTech app’s users is crucial for the success of the business. You can ensure exactly that with cross-platform app development; this form of development involves a variety of advanced frameworks which include a plethora of components and widgets which can be easily tailored to suit the company’s requirements. This, in turn, allows developers to build avant-garde apps with top-notch UI and UX that offer look and feel comparable to that of native apps.
